Wash your hands
Read the tampon package instructions
Choose the smallest absorbency you can use comfortably
Get into a relaxed position, such as sitting on the toilet or standing with one foot raised
Unwrap the tampon
Hold the tampon at the grip area
Separate the labia with your free hand
Aim the tampon toward your lower back, not straight up
Gently insert the tip into the vaginal opening
Push it in until your fingers touch your body
If using an applicator, push the inner tube with your index finger until the tampon is fully inside
If using a non-applicator tampon, use your finger to place it comfortably inside
Leave the string hanging outside the body
If it feels uncomfortable, remove it and try again with a new tampon
Change the tampon every 4 to 8 hours
Never leave a tampon in for more than 8 hours
Remove it by gently pulling the string
Wash your hands after removal
Seek medical help if you cannot remove it, have severe pain, or develop fever, rash, or unusual discharge
